What are the important consequences of Schottky and Frenkel defects in crystals ? |
|
Answer» Solution :The important consequences of Schottky and Frenkel defects in crystals are given below: i) Because of these defects, the electrical conductivity of crystals increases. When an electric FIELD is applied, a nearby ion moves from its lattice site to occupy a hole. This creates a new hole and another nearby ion moves into it and so on. This process goes on and a hole moves from one end to other end. Thus, it CONDUCTS electricity. (ii) Due to the presence of HOLES in the crystals, its density decreases. (iii) The presence of holes also decreases like lattice energy of the crystal. Conscquently, the crystal becomes less stable. |

What isthesignificanceof leachingin theextractionofaluminium ? |
|
Answer» Solution :Bauxineis the principleore of aluminium. It usually contains silica `(SiO_2) `, ironoxide` (Fe_2O_3) `andtitanium oxide `(TiO_2) `as impurities. These impurities can beremovedbytheprocessof LEACHING. Duringleaching, thepowdered bauxine oreis heatedwithaconcentrated(45%) solution ofNaOHat 473 - 523 Kand35 - 36 barpressurewhen aluminadissolves as sodium meta- aluminate and silica`(SiO_2) `as sodiumsilicateleaving` Fe_2O_3, TiO_2 `and other impurities behind. ` underset ("Alumina")(Al_2O_3(s)) +2 NaOH (AQ)+3 H _2 O(l)overset ( 473 - 523K) underset (35 - 36" bar pressure") tounderset ("Sodium meta-aluminate")(2NA[Al(OH)_4](aq) ` ` underset ("Silica")(SiO_(2)(l)) + 2 NaOH (aq) underset (473 - 523K) tounderset ("Sodiumsilicate")(Na_2SiO_3(aq)) +H_ 2 O(l) ` Theimpuritiesare filtered off andthe solution of sodiummeta- aluminateis neutralizedbypassing` CO_ 2` when hydratedaluminaseparatesoutwhilesodiumsilicateremainsinthesolution. ` ""2Na[Al(OH)_4](aq) +2CO _2(g)toAl_2 O _3. x H_2O(s) downarrow+2 NaHCO_3(aq) ` Thehydratedalumina thusobtainedisfiltered, driedandheatedto give backpure alumina. ` "" Al _2O_ 3 . xH _2 O (s)overset ( 1473 K) toAl_2 O _3(s)+xH_2O (g)` Thus,the significanceof leachingintheextractionofaluminiumis topreparepurealuminafro thebauxiteore. |

Write structures of different isomers corresponding to the molecular formula C_3 H_9N. Write IUPAC name of the isomers which will liberate nitrogen gas on treatment with nitrous acid. |
|
Answer» SOLUTION :In all FOUR structural isomers are possible. These are : ` 1^@` AMINE ` underset("Propan-1-amine ")(CH_3 CH_2 CH_2 NH_2) underset("Propan-2-amine ")(CH_3 - underset(NH_2)underset(|)(CH -CH_3)` ` 2^@ `Amines : ` underset("N-Methylethanamine ")(CH_3 -NH -C_2 H_5)` `3^@`Amine : ` underset("N,N-dimethylmethanamine ")(CH_3 - overset(CH_3) overset(|)N-CH_3)` Only `1^@`amines react with `HNO_2` to liberate `N_2` gas ` underset("Propan-1-amine ")(CH_3 CH_2 CH_2 NH_2 +HNO_2) tounderset("Propan-1-ol (major product)")(CH_3CH_2 CH_2 OH +H_2 O +N_2)`
